Outlander is an action driving video game with a post-apocalyptic theme. It was rumoured that it was to be titled Mad Max 2: The Road Warrior, following suit from Mindscape's previous Nintendo NES Mad Max title based on the same movie, however Warner Brothers did not give Mindscape the required rights. Mindscape edited the graphics and changed the name from Mad Max II into Outlander. Along with the similarities to the Mad Max universe including their own version of the V8 Interceptor, there is a tribute on the life bar meter on the bottom of the screen. It says "MAX" but it was placed there to serve more as a homage as opposed to letting the player know they had maximum health. The game has achieved Cult status among Mad Max fans and Retro Gamer fans alike. The game was developed and published by Mindscape in 1992 for the Sega Genesis and in 1993 for the Super Nintendo.
